Where to Watch the Los Angeles Kings in Minneapolis, MN

Streaming services · Sports bars · TV channels · Blackout info

Catching all the thrilling Los Angeles Kings action from Minneapolis, MN, is easier than you think, even if you're far from the Staples Center. For out-of-market fans, streaming services are your best bet. Platforms like ESPN+ are essential for a wide range of NHL games, often including Kings matchups, while services such as Hulu + Live TV, Sling TV, FuboTV, and DirecTV Stream offer access to channels like ESPN, TNT, and NHL Network, which broadcast many games. Additionally, many sports bars across Minneapolis are dedicated to showing major league sports, including hockey, providing a fantastic atmosphere to cheer on the Kings with fellow fans. Be mindful of NHL blackout rules, which can sometimes restrict local broadcasts if the Wild are playing, but these typically don't affect out-of-market teams like the Kings. Frequently Asked Questions

Where can I watch the Los Angeles Kings in Minneapolis?

In Minneapolis, you can watch Los Angeles Kings games primarily through streaming services that carry NHL broadcasts. ESPN+ is a great option for out-of-market games. Live TV streaming services like Hulu + Live TV, Sling TV, FuboTV, and DirecTV Stream provide access to channels such as ESPN, TNT, and NHL Network. Many local sports bars in Minneapolis also show NHL games, offering a lively communal viewing experience.

Can I watch Los Angeles Kings games for free in Minneapolis?

Watching Los Angeles Kings games for free in Minneapolis is generally not possible through official channels, as most broadcasts require a subscription to a streaming service or cable package. Some streaming services offer free trials, which could allow temporary free access. Public venues like sports bars might show games without a direct cost to you, but you would typically purchase food or drinks.

Are Los Angeles Kings games blacked out in Minneapolis?

Los Angeles Kings games are typically not blacked out in Minneapolis. NHL blackout rules primarily apply to in-market games, meaning if the Minnesota Wild are playing, their games might be blacked out on certain services in the local area. As the Kings are an out-of-market team for Minneapolis, you should generally be able to stream or watch their games without local blackout restrictions, especially on services like ESPN+.
